Free GED classes offered

Shawnee Community College’s Adult Education Program will offer GED classes in Anna, Cairo, Metropolis, Vienna and at the college’s main campus in Ullin this upcoming fall.

These classes are at no cost to the student.  Classes begin August 22, 2017.

In Anna, GED classes will be held at the Shawnee Community College Anna Extension Center every Tuesday and Thursday from 1:30 p.m. to 4:30 p.m. and 5:30 p.m. to 8:30 p.m.

An Introduction to Computers class will be offered at the same location every Monday and Wednesday from 10:00 a.m to 12:00 p.m. and 1:00 p.m. to 3:00 p.m.

In Cairo, GED classes will be held at the Shawnee Community College Cairo Extension Center now located at Cairo High School.  Classes will be held every Tuesday and Thursday from 5:30 p.m. to 8:30 p.m.

In Metropolis, GED classes will be held at the Spence Community Center every Tuesday and Thursday from 9:00 a.m. to 12:00 p.m.

A Basic Computers class will be offered at the same location every Monday and Wednesday from 10:00 a.m. to 12:00 p.m.

In Ullin, GED classes will be held at the Shawnee Community College main campus every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day, and Thursday from 1:00 p.m. to 4:00 p.m.  A Bridge to Health Careers class will be offered at the same location every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day, and Thursday from 9:00 a.m. to 12:00 p.m.

In Vienna, GED classes will be held at Vienna High School every Monday and Wednesday from 5:00 p.m. to 8:00 p.m.
